Some great remakes on this thread.

For those of you who like the look of the "MYTH" remake (seen in the 1st post),
you may be interested to hear that the same guys are now also remaking ARMALYTE.

Interestingly, this will be an "official" remake (the IP owner has given his OK)
and also a commercial release. (ie it'll come in a proper box, with nice artwork)





You can read about it on the official Psytronik blog.
And if you want much more detail, here's my interview about Armalyte PC with the 3 devs.

It won't be ready for quite a while, but I'm hoping when it DOES come out,
they'll finally get back to working on their Stunt Car Racer remake.
